India is a land of immense diversity, yet a common thread binds its population: the centrality of the family. From the bustling metropolitan apartments of Mumbai to the serene courtyards of rural Rajasthan, the Indian family lifestyle is a dynamic blend of deep-rooted traditions and modern aspirations. Understanding daily life in an Indian household requires looking beyond the colorful festivals and diving into the quiet, meaningful rhythms of their everyday routines.

The daily life story of an Indian family almost always begins before the sun rises. Morning routines are deeply grounded in spiritual and physical wellness.

While the millennials sleep, the house is already alive. Grandfather does his pranayama (yoga breathing) on the balcony. Grandmother lights the diyas (lamps) in the pooja room. The maid hasn't arrived yet, so the "broom versus dust" battle begins. The first cup of chai (tea) is brewed—strong, sweet, and spicy. This is the only hour of silence.
